15 facts about this song
ArtistThe song "Wildest Dreams" is made by British heavy metal band Iron Maiden.
|
Album Inclusion"Wildest Dreams" is the first track from their 13th studio album, named "Dance of Death", released in 2003.
|
Single ReleaseThe song was released as their first single from the "Dance of Death" album on September 1, 2003.
|
Charts PerformanceIt reached the No.10 spot on the Official Singles Chart in the United Kingdom, marking a success for the band.
